Commit Graph

204 Commits

Author SHA1 Message Date
Neocky
2631f8e758
Updated Usage & added donations header 2021-03-13 23:05:46 +01:00
Neocky
ddb5f1172e Made config path correct; Deleted unnecessary stuff; Beautified outpout; Plugin version now correct;
Changes:
- config path will always be correct
- deleted unnexessary stuff
- plugin version will display now correct
- changed some formating
- created SFTP check before launching
2021-03-13 22:09:32 +01:00
Neocky
3fed1580f8 Every plugin has now an array entry; Beautified the output
Changes:
- added latest version of plugin to installedplugin array
- fixed issue when array couldn't be created; Now the array will always be created
- added bright Green to console Output
- deleted debug output for the  innput
2021-03-13 19:21:03 +01:00
Neocky
0d17bfe25b
Added remove example input 2021-03-12 01:44:39 +01:00
Neocky
ac561d92ce Split everything in sub packages; Created main function; Added many exception handlers for SFTP
Added:
- Split everything into sub packages
- created a main file: __main__.py
- added many exception handlings with SFTP

Edited:
- launcher.bat calls now the __main__.py file
2021-03-12 01:39:39 +01:00
Neocky
36c96f7d23
Format fixing 2021-03-11 14:35:29 +01:00
Neocky
69baf1550b
Added line break 2021-03-11 14:30:04 +01:00
Neocky
a18fef3261
Added line standalone program 2021-03-11 14:24:28 +01:00
Neocky
07396bd543
Little things here and there 2021-03-11 14:22:21 +01:00
Neocky
4974ca180d
Added line breaks 2021-03-11 14:02:15 +01:00
Neocky
21311d5c26
Edited about topic 2021-03-11 13:01:10 +01:00
Neocky
1aae4bf9d3 Removed error when yaml file is in plugin folder & created file in which the remove plugin function comes 2021-03-10 23:49:57 +01:00
Neocky
db13b79a39
Edited misc stuff 2021-03-10 23:13:07 +01:00
Neocky
6b46e134a2
Edited about & added need help 2021-03-10 15:00:24 +01:00
Neocky
6915b213dc Added SFTP Support & Requirements check 2021-03-10 02:05:56 +01:00
Neocky
db404a7a61
Update README.md 2021-03-09 20:58:40 +01:00
Neocky
a1d839cf47
Added links for shields 2021-03-09 20:57:17 +01:00
Neocky
fb65705a59
Added shields 2021-03-09 20:53:07 +01:00
Neocky
8ff1faa76f
Merge pull request #1 from Neocky/add-license-1
Added the Apache License, Version 2.0
2021-03-09 20:27:45 +01:00
Neocky
0cfb829607
Added the Apache License, Version 2.0 2021-03-09 20:27:06 +01:00
Neocky
4756c0c10e
Update README.md 2021-03-09 00:18:33 +01:00
Neocky
57a641b3b7
Changed order of commands 2021-03-08 22:28:00 +01:00
Neocky
bba33176a7
Added config and new functions 2021-03-08 22:26:44 +01:00
Neocky
53ae3b5a64 Config support added; Added utilities.py; Clean up of code
Added:
- .ini config support
- lancher.bat to launch program
- added utilities.py for help function

Removed:
- old ununsed input handlers functions
- old ununsed download handler functions
- removed many print()s
2021-03-08 22:13:57 +01:00
Neocky
37d71e6b4b
Changed header to dependencies 2021-03-08 13:50:01 +01:00
Neocky
ea879e3ad3
Fixed typo 2021-03-08 13:48:50 +01:00
Neocky
ee6d24a3a2
Added usage doc 2021-03-08 03:13:31 +01:00
Neocky
4c5e3b9235 Merge branch 'main' of https://github.com/Neocky/pluGET into main 2021-03-08 02:56:05 +01:00
Neocky
8212f66e90 New input system; Only one download function now; Specific plugin updater added and check for all installed plugins;
Removed:
- cloudscraper
- unnecessary functions

Added:
- new input system;
-> Now it is like a console
- general download function
- specific version updater
- check for updates on all installed version
2021-03-08 02:56:00 +01:00
Neocky
52d6d2b9e1
Fixed format of python header 2021-03-07 23:39:43 +01:00
Neocky
ed15790d97 Merge branch 'main' of https://github.com/Neocky/pluGET into main 2021-03-07 01:49:59 +01:00
Neocky
e698803c87 Renamed folder to src\; Added new input system and added a specific plugin downloader for testing 2021-03-07 01:49:57 +01:00
Neocky
c769cd534a
Edited installation topic 2021-03-06 22:14:13 +01:00
Neocky
b734c3aa30
Updated logo 2021-03-05 20:20:11 +01:00
Neocky
f44f06a803 Fixed input handling and added web_request file to simplify the code 2021-03-05 00:09:03 +01:00
Neocky
91e66792a3
Updated first text 2021-03-04 23:06:25 +01:00
Neocky
a40c2c115b
Update README.md 2021-03-04 23:00:28 +01:00
Neocky
8fde18eda7
Updated logo final 2021-03-04 22:59:19 +01:00
Neocky
ce62a86e86
Update README.md 2021-03-04 22:48:16 +01:00
Neocky
d76a90d8cf
Updated logo 2021-03-04 22:46:27 +01:00
Neocky
fd90b86e87 Finished the local plugin auto downloader function.
Added:
- console color red
- two dimensional array for plugins
- finished it with a deletion of old files
2021-03-03 23:25:44 +01:00
Neocky
a713a63264 Added handle_input.py & query for plugin id 2021-03-03 17:13:43 +01:00
Neocky
ba4aa69173 Formatted code and added test query to plugin updater 2021-03-03 00:17:15 +01:00
Neocky
42732d1ea5 Code restructure, added latest version download & requirements for update checker
- Everything is now in functions
- added download of latest update for plugin
- added first things for an update checker
2021-03-01 23:39:48 +01:00
Neocky
10a19122eb Merge branch 'main' of https://github.com/Neocky/pluGET into main 2021-02-27 01:36:20 +01:00
Neocky
29706eb795 Added folder and updated output espacially the logo 2021-02-27 01:36:16 +01:00
Neocky
dc5f2626ce
Updated picture 2021-02-27 01:10:27 +01:00
Neocky
8c617da140
Updated picture 2021-02-27 01:05:57 +01:00
Neocky
f24d512be5
Updated spigot plugin link and added spigot link 2021-02-26 10:24:50 +01:00
Neocky
34e53f4861 Added initial files
Added:
- consoleouput.py
- plugin_downloader.py
2021-02-26 01:22:16 +01:00